The problem with the debate over Apple's withdrawal of Advanced Data Protection is its presented as; either we have encrypted privacy or we don't.
While the UK wanted to break the privacy lock, it did attach a clear legal process to demand(s); but I suspect Apple's main problem was the extraterritorial reach of the proposed capacity.
Critics rightly worry about state snooping; supporters point to criminal & abusive activity.
But in a polarised debate there can now be no middle ground?
